Oge O.

This is undoubtably one of if not THE BEST barbecue I have ever had in all my years. I went here on a whim during the (beryl) storm. They were one of the only places in the area serving hot food and Im glad I did because driving by you probably wouldn't notice its small sign.., I was mind blown. The meat was so flavorful gigantic and succulent! I had the coleslaw and green beans for my sides. They both were perfect && I'm not a fan of canned geeen beans but these were sooo well seasoned it made no difference!! . This blows papas barbecue out of the water. I hate to say that, but this is authentic Texas barbecue !!! Smokey & oh soooo flavorful ! The best! highly recommended 10/19!!! These pictures do them no justice.

Angela A.

I've been living near Bellaire, TX for around 2 years now and I pass the this bbq spot pretty often. I've always thought about trying but never did until around a month ago. Way better than I ever expected! I recently visited for the second time and I ordered the Fancy Stuffed Potato. Everything from the potato and ingredients within the potato were very succulent! The beef was cooked well and seasoned perfectly. I also ordered the green beans and peach cobbler on the side. The peach cobbler was good despite what I initially assumed. The times that I have been to this bbq spot it's always pretty empty, but I've only gone during the late evening, so I'm not sure of the traffic they may get earlier in the day. However, I definitely plan to eat here again!

Gene L.

I was driving down Rice Ave and could not help smelling the smoke from this place. I was hungry and happened to be craving BBQ at that exact moment so I thought I'd give it a go. The portions were humongous! I got the ribs and brisket plate. The side selection is limited, but they do give you quite a bit. The ribs were 4/5 - very well cooked, moist, tender and smokey - loved them! The brisket was a different story - tough and dry...I feel like I could make better brisket - I'd give it 2/5. As some other reviewers have pointed out, the sauce was definitely a winner. I have to admit that I'm the type of person who seems to like sauces on the sweeter side, but I found this sauce very good even though it wasn't sweet at all. If I come by again, I'll just stick with the ribs.
